Hi,
I have installed the new bootloader(CVSupped Monday morning),
recompiled my KERNEL as ELF, added "options FFS_ROOT",
did a "disklabel -B wd0", and happily rebooted.
the new bootloader showed up, telling me about drive 0/drive1 and some
more BIOs information, when suddenly I got this message:
FreeBSD/i386 bootstrap loader....
(lickyou@pentium, Mon Oct 5 20:21:30 GMT 1998)
Can't work out which disk we are booting from.
Guessed BIOS device 0xffffffff not found by probes, defaulting to disk
0:
can't open `/boot/boot.conf`: input/output error
<countdown here, when it gets to zero it tries loading the kernel from
drive A: with no success and then drops me to the command
line prompt)
When I type "load disk1c:/kernel" from the command line it loads the
kernel,
then I type "boot" and it appears to boot fine, filesystem checks OK,
but I get the infamous "mount: /dev/wd0s2a on /: specifed device does
not
match mounted device" when trying to mount the root device.
(from then, It just boots single user with the root filesystem read
only).
I have reserved my aout kernel as /kernel.aout and I can boot it just
fine
at the "boot:" prompt, all filesystem checks are OK and mount does not
complain.
